Output d76bf1bb08489a795ec9fa67b0d8f24725afe8c11774f4d93f9be9272684a6a4:18

value
37000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fabc1bc7ba5062e14c6c17d574b91a605cece438 OP_EQUAL
address
3QYnCWYbHyzzHXK477GMaihBkwtQNeyvnA
transaction
d76bf1bb08489a795ec9fa67b0d8f24725afe8c11774f4d93f9be9272684a6a4
spent
true